Erro na reposição de dados no SQL 2008 Express
Tenho um backup feito no SQL 2000 e estou a tentar repor numa nova instancia no SQL 2008 Express e está a dar a seguinte mensagem de erro:
TITLE: Microsoft SQL Server Management Studio
------------------------------Restore failed for Server 'SERVIDOR\INSTANCIA'. (Microsoft.SqlServer.SmoExtended)
------------------------------
ADDITIONAL INFORMATION:System.Data.SqlClient.SqlError: Could not continue scan with NOLOCK due to data movement. (Microsoft.SqlServer.Smo)
For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&ProdVer=10.0.2531.0+((Katmai_PCU_Main).090329-1015+)&LinkId=20476
------------------------------
BUTTONS:OK
------------------------------
Agradecia a v/ ajuda.
AMTRSB
Todas as Respostas
Por favor, posta o comando que vc está utilizando para executar o restore.
Abs.
Ivan Candido - http://ivandba.spaces.live.com- AMTRSB,
Qual é o tamanho deste banco de dados?
De que forma você esta tentando restaurar o backup?
Pedro Antonio Galvão Junior - MVP - Windows Server System - SQL Server/Coordenador de Projetos/DBA - Estou a fazer o restore através do Management Studio do SQL (tasks/restore/database).
O backup tem cerca de 60.000 KB.
Tenho varios backups em dias diferentes e todos dão o mesmo problema na reposição.
Se fizer a reposição numa instancia do SQL 2000 não dá erro, fica OK.
AMTRSB - AMTRSB,
A nível de informação o SQL Server Express suporta banco de dados de até 4GB.
O tamanho do seu banco de dados é bem menor em relação a esta limitação.
O banco de dados já existe no SQL Server 2008?
Pedro Antonio Galvão Junior - MVP - Windows Server System - SQL Server/Coordenador de Projetos/DBA Junior Galvão,
Não, o Banco de dados ainda não existe no SQL 2008 mas já criei um banco de dados e tentei repor nesse mesmo banco e deu o mesmo erro.
Se fizer por attach dá o seguinte erro:
TITLE: Microsoft SQL Server Management Studio
------------------------------Attach database failed for Server 'SERVIDOR\INSTANCIA'. (Microsoft.SqlServer.Smo)
------------------------------
ADDITIONAL INFORMATION:An exception occurred while executing a Transact-SQL statement or batch. (Microsoft.SqlServer.ConnectionInfo)
------------------------------
Could not continue scan with NOLOCK due to data movement.
Converting database 'PRI145' from version 539 to the current version 655.
Database 'PRI145' running the upgrade step from version 539 to version 551. (Microsoft SQL Server, Error: 601)For help, click: http://go.microsoft.com/fwlink?ProdName=Microsoft+SQL+Server&ProdVer=10.00.2531&EvtSrc=MSSQLServer&EvtID=601&LinkId=20476
------------------------------
BUTTONS:OK
------------------------------
AMTRSB

